A Friend of Mine – 2011

70-year-old Mati is a passionate bibliophile whose job is his hobby – he´s got a job at the library. The rest of his little time he shares with his sweet wife. Then one sudden day death comes to his spouse. A whole life of stability crashes. Neither his adolescent daughter nor his dear books are of any help. Loneliness and indifference overrun his life and Mati plots his suicide. A strange 60-year- old wayfarer, Sass, who travels with a backpack of books and frequents public libraries to read the newspapers, brings forth a change. Bit by bit he starts to provide Mati with an interest in life again. “A Friend of Mine” is a warm expression of solitude and friendship, which helps us to overcome the bleakest periods of life.

Director : Mart Kivastik
Cast : Aarne Üksküla|Aleksander Eelmaa|Harriet Toompere|Indrek Kalda|Ingmar-Erik Kiviloo|Markus Luik|Raivo Adlas|Rita Raave|Sulev Teppart|Tõnu Oja
Genre : Drama
Release Date : 1/7/2011
Country : Estonia

Engeyum Eppodhum – 2011

Engeyum Eppodhum revolves around a group of passengers traveling in two different buses, each having their own past and a reason for their travel. The most prominent among these passengers is the love track between Kathiresan (Jai), Manimegalai (Anjali) and the other between Vinay (Saravanandh) and Amudha (Ananya).Jai is a responsible young person who works as a mechanic and secretly loves his neighbour Anjali, but Anjali is an extremely practical girl and believes that love alone doesn’t suffice life. The evolution of their love through these forms the crux of their relationship….

Director : M. Saravanan
Cast : Ananya|Anjali|Deepthi Nambiar|Jai Sampath|Mithun Maheshwaran|Sharwanand|Vatsan|Vinodhini Vaidyanathan
Genre : Drama
Release Date : 9/16/2011
Country : India
